Understanding Reverse Osmosis Antiscalant Chemistry

Reverse RO units rely antiscalants to avoid calcium carbonate formation on the RO membranes. These kinds of agents typically work by modifying the growth of insoluble particles, such as calcium and magnesium. Several classes are used, including phosphonates, polyacrylates, and organophosphonates, each possessing a distinct mode of function. Understanding the specific antiscalant's interaction under system situations, including pH, temperature, and solution quality, is vital for maintaining RO efficiency and lowering operational expenses.

Selecting the Right RO Chemical Treatment for The Needs

Choosing the best RO antiscalant can be a tricky process. Many factors determine the preferred selection. These encompass your source water's particular chemistry – especially its hardness and acidity . Multiple antiscalant formulations work differently and are formulated to prevent particular scale-forming deposits , such as calcium carbonate , calcium sulfate , and silicates. Evaluate performing a detailed water test and speaking with a knowledgeable water purification professional to ensure you obtain the most solution for consistent RO unit operation.
